International News: UK Asbestos Comp Disallowed for Multi-Employer Workers

18 December 2001

Unions were this week disappointed by news that people suffering from asbestos-related diseases were dealt a major blow on Tuesday when a British court ruled that they did not qualify for compensation if they had been exposed while working for more than one employer.

The Appeal Court ruling by three of the country's top judges backed previous court rulings on the sensitive issue.

The court refused leave to appeal to the House of Lords but claimants may still renew their application directly to the Law Lords for leave to appeal.

Tuesday's ruling followed six test case appeals involving claimants who have suffered or may suffer from asbestos-induced mesothelioma after being exposed to asbestos working for more than one employer.
